The Tops (10 Pieces)
Layering is key for fall, so I included ten tops that can stand alone early in the season and layer easily as it gets colder:
- Cotton cashmere sweater in berry from Quince: XS | true to size, you could size up if in between sizes | sleeves are a little bit long and need to be cuffed | lightweight (in-stock petite option) | 65% organic cotton, 32% ecovero viscose, 3% cashmere
- Cropped floral top from Anthropologie: Petite XXS | true to size | 100% cotton
- Navy cashmere sweater from Quince: XS | true to size, with a little bit of extra room | sleeves are a little bit long and need to be cuffed | 100% mongolian cashmere
- Striped Polo Top from J.Crew: XXS | true to size, with a slim fit, I could personally go up a size in this and it would still fit well, the sleeves are a little bit long | 57% cotton/39% Modal rayon/4% elastane
- Striped Ruffle Neck Button Down from J.Crew Factory: Petite XXS | true to size, slim tailored fit, may need a size up to accommodate a larger chest | 98% regenagri®-certified cotton/2% elastane
- White Button Down Top from J.Crew Factory: Petite XXS | true to size, slim tailored fit, may need a size up to accommodate a larger chest | white is sheer, wear with a nude bra | 100% cotton
- Duster Cardigan from Amazon: XS | a little oversized with long sleeves, I wear them cuffed | color is “apricort” the first color option on the list, it does not look the same online as it does in person | 50% viscose, 30% nylon, 20% PBT
- Camel Sweater from Quince: XS | oversized and boxy, sleeves are long and are worn cuffed | 100% organic cotton, machine washable
- White Long Sleeve Top from Quince: XS | true to size, not see through, stretchy with a slim fit that’s easy to tuck in | 91% organic cotton, 9% spandex
- Navy Turtleneck from J.Crew: XXS | true to size, slim fit and sheer, a great layering piece but is too sheer to wear alone | 100% cotton
The Jackets & Coats (4 Pieces)
I included four jackets and coats, not because I think you need all four, but I wanted to show some variety. There are two lightweight options and two warm options that will take you through winter:
- Swing barn jacket from Anthropologie: Petite XXS | true to size with great sleeve length, the jacket has a flared out voluminous fit at the bottom | 100% cotton
- Cropped trench coat from Artizia: XXS in marcona beige | generous fit, I have sized down for Aritzia sizing | sleeves are long for petites, but the jacket has buckles you can use to cinch and secure the sleeves | 100% cotton
- Tan coat from Banana Republic Factory: Petite XXS | true to size with enough room to layer | perfect sleeve length and shoulder fit | very warm, will take you through the winter season | 52% polyester, 40% wool, 8% other fibers
- Burgundy cropped coat from J.Crew Factory: Petite XXS | true to size, perfect sleeve length | swing voluminous fit through the body | 48% wool/48% polyester/4% other fibers, dry clean
The Bottoms (4 Pieces)
I chose three different cuts for the jeans and pants to fit different preferences and one skirt for variety:
- Perfect vintage wide leg jeans from Madewell in pipestone wash: Petite 24 | 10.5″ rise | 28″ inseam | stretch denim | the jeans buckle on me with flats and have enough length for heels, I find this length the most versatile for my height | 81% cotton/6% recycled polyester/3% elastane | (more wide leg jeans here)
- Bella straight jeans from Quince in midnight blue: 24 x 26″ | 10.5″ rise | stretch denim | 94% organic cotton, 5% elasterell-p, 1% lycra
- Flare corduroy pants from J.Crew in pale bone: Petite 24 | not see through | low stretch, a little snug on my thighs but loosens with wear | 10.5″ rise | 29″ inseam I can only wear these with the heeled boots | 98% cotton/2% elastane
- Faux suede mini skirt in walnut: 0 | recommend a size up if you’re wide through the hips, otherwise true to size | fully lined | 100% polyester, machine washable
